|
|
|
|
|
Dicas
|
|
Visual Basic (Miscelâneas)
|
|
|
Título da Dica: Use o With para atribuir valores à propriedades de objetos
|
|
|
|
Postada em 14/8/2000 por Webmaster
webmaster@vbweb.com.br
Digamos que você necessite mudar as propriedades de um objeto, um Label por exemplo. Então, veja:
'(01) Ao invéz de: Label1.AutoSize = True Label1.Caption = "Blá, blá, blá..." Label1.Enabled = True Label1.Visible = True Label1.Refresh
'(02) Use: With Label1 .AutoSize = True .Caption = "Blá, blá, blá..." .Enabled = True .Visible = True .Refresh End With Motivo: No exemplo 01, ele carrega na memória, uma instância do objeto para cada atribuição, no caso, cria 5 instâncias. Já na segunda, ele cria APENAS uma instância, ficando assim, mais rápido.
|
|
|
|
|